Abstract

A prerendered line texture stored in memory is used to generate an anti-aliased destination line in any direction to be displayed on a screen. A combination of tiling, stretching, and/or mirroring is used to generate the anti-aliased destination line. A blitter blits a rectangle in the prerendered line texture to a destination rectangle in the frame buffer that is displayed on the screen.

Claims (28)

1. A system to render a line on a screen display, comprising:

a memory;

a frame buffer to store data to be displayed on the screen display;

a processor to create a prerendered line texture having a line segment comprising a plurality of pixels to store in the memory, the processor to generate a source rectangle in the memory and a destination rectangle in a frame buffer that corresponds to at least a portion of a destination line wherein the destination line is a diagonal line having a vertical component and a horizontal component; and

a blitter to blit the prerendered line texture from the source rectangle in the memory to the destination rectangle in the frame buffer, wherein to render the destination line the blitter stretches the prerendered line texture only in a direction corresponding to the longer of the vertical and horizontal components and tiles the entire stretched prerendered line texture only in a direction corresponding to the shorter of the vertical and horizontal components, and wherein the coordinates of the destination rectangle for a particular blit are determined to maintain continuity of the destination diagonal line.

2. The system of claim 1 , wherein the processor determines a number of blits required to generate the destination diagonal line in a direction corresponding to the shorter of the vertical and horizontal components.

3. The system of claim 1 , wherein the processor determines a number of pixels required to be added to each blit to generate the destination diagonal line in a direction corresponding to the longer of the vertical and horizontal components.

4. The system of claim 1 , wherein a plurality of blits is required to generate the destination diagonal line, and for each blit, the processor determines new coordinates in the frame buffer for the destination rectangle to generate the destination diagonal line.

5. The system of claim 1 , wherein the prerendered line texture includes anti-aliasing pixels.

6. The system of claim 5 , wherein an intensity of the anti-aliasing pixels varies as distance of the anti-aliasing pixels from a center of the prerendered line texture.

7. The system of claim 1 , wherein the prerendered line texture has square dimensions.

8. The system of claim 1 , wherein the pixels in the prerendered line texture are rendered in the alpha channel.

9. The system of claim 8 , wherein the pixels in the prerendered line texture default according to a default color for the alpha channel.

10. A method for rendering a destination diagonal line, having a vertical component and a horizontal component, on a screen display, comprising:

storing a prerendered line texture having a line segment and having a plurality of pixels in a memory;

generating a source rectangle in the memory;

generating a destination rectangle in a frame buffer that corresponds to at least a portion of the destination diagonal line to be displayed on the screen display;

determining coordinates for the destination rectangle that maintain continuity of the destination diagonal line; and

blitting the prerendered line texture from the source rectangle in the memory to the destination rectangle in the frame buffer, wherein to render the destination diagonal line the prerendered line texture is stretched only in a direction corresponding to the longer of the vertical and horizontal components and the entire prerendered line texture is tiled only in a direction corresponding to the shorter of the vertical and horizontal components.

11. The method of claim 10 , further comprising determining a number of blits required to generate the destination diagonal line in a direction corresponding to the shorter of the vertical and horizontal components.

12. The method of claim 10 , further comprising determining a number of pixels required to be added to each blit to generate the destination diagonal line in a direction corresponding to the longer of the vertical and horizontal components.

13. The method of claim 10 , further comprising:

determining a number of blits required to generate the destination diagonal line, and for each blit, determining new coordinates in the frame buffer for the destination rectangle to generate the destination diagonal line.

14. The method of claim 10 , further comprising including anti-aliasing pixels in the prerendered line texture.

15. The method of claim 14 , further comprising varying an intensity of the anti-aliasing pixels in accordance with distance of the anti-aliasing pixels from a center of the prerendered line texture.

16. The method of claim 10 , further comprising generating a square-dimensioned prerendered line texture.

17. The method of claim 10 , further comprising rendering the pixels in the prerendered line texture in the alpha channel.

18. The method of claim 17 , further comprising rendering the pixels in the prerendered line texture default according to a default color for the alpha channel.
